How Long Does a Cathay Pacific Refund Take?

Cathay Pacific aims to process refunds as efficiently as possible, but timelines can vary depending on several factors. Here's a general breakdown of what to expect for different payment methods:

1. Credit/Debit Card Refunds

For tickets purchased using a credit or debit card:

  • Processing Time: 7 to 14 business days
    • Once Cathay Pacific processes the refund, your bank may take additional time to post it to your account.

2. Cash or Bank Transfer Refunds

If you paid for your ticket in cash, bank transfer, or directly at a ticketing office:

  • Processing Time: 30 calendar days
    • These refunds can take longer as they often require manual handling.

3. Travel Agency Bookings

If your ticket was booked via a travel agent:

  • Processing Time: Varies by the agency
    • Refund requests may be delayed as Cathay Pacific needs to coordinate with the travel agency.

Factors That Impact the Cathay Pacific Refund Timeline

Several circumstances can influence how quickly Cathay Pacific processes your refund. Knowing these factors can help you anticipate delays:

  1. Refund Type: Refunds related to voluntary cancellations may take longer than refunds for flight disruptions.
  2. Payment Method: Credit/debit card refunds are faster than cash or bank transfers.
  3. Volume of Requests: During peak travel seasons, such as holidays, refund processing times may be extended.
  4. Supporting Documentation: Missing or incomplete documentation can push back the timeline.

How to Check the Status of Your Cathay Pacific Refund

Your refund status can usually be checked online, but you may need your booking reference or ticket number. Here’s how:

  • Step 1: Visit the Cathay Pacific Manage Booking page.
  • Step 2: Log in with your booking reference and last name.
  • Step 3: Navigate to the refund section to see updates.

For tickets booked through travel agencies, it’s best to contact the agency directly for status updates on your refund.

Comparing Refund Timelines: Table Summary

For quick reference, here’s a summary of Cathay Pacific refund timelines based on different payment methods and booking scenarios:

Payment Method / Booking Type Refund Timeframe Additional Notes
Credit/Debit Card 7–14 business days Bank processing times may vary.
Cash or Bank Transfer Up to 30 calendar days Manual handling required.
Travel Agencies Varies by agency Contact your travel agency for specifics.
Flight Disruptions (Involuntary) Typically faster (7–10 days) Prioritized in the system.

Frequently Asked Questions About Cathay Pacific Refunds

1. How do I request a refund from Cathay Pacific?

You can request a refund via the Cathay Pacific refund request page. Log in with your booking details, select the flight you wish to refund, and follow the instructions.

2. Can I get an instant refund for a canceled flight?

Instant refunds are not available. Most refunds take between 7–30 days, depending on the payment method and refund type.

3. Why is my Cathay Pacific refund taking so long?

Refund delays can occur due to incomplete documentation, high request volumes, or additional processing requirements for non-card payments.

4. Are refunds given automatically for flight disruptions?

Refunds for flight cancellations or schedule changes are not always automatic. You must submit a refund request unless otherwise notified by Cathay Pacific.
